Kovatch Mobile Equipment Corp. (KME) is recalling certain model year 2015-2016 Predator Severe Service vehicles manufactured August 28, 2014, to January 27, 2016. The affected vehicles are equipped with Pelican 9410L flashlights, part number 9410-021-245 or 9410-021-110, with lithium ion battery packs, part number 9413-301-001, which may overheat. If the flashlight battery pack overheats, it can increase the risk of a fire.

What you should do
KME will notify owners to inspect the flashlights and battery packs, and request replacements from Pelican, as necessary, free of charge. The recall began on June 16, 2016. Owners may contact KME customer service at 1-800-235-3926.
